Abstract

The utility model relates to a two-shot file shooting device which has a pedestal, a folding bracing frame, and a shooting head which is arranged on the front end of the folding bracing frame. The two-shot file shooting device is characterized in that the folding bracing frame includes two folding sections which are rotatably connected via a first rotating shaft; the upper section can be completely stored into a grooved type space of the lower section; the front end of the upper bracing frame is provided with a shooting portion, and the shooting portion is connected with the upper bracing frame via a second rotating shaft; a side of the upper bracing frame facing the inside is provided with a video shooting portion, the video shooting portion is arranged in a vacant portion which is embedded in the middle of the upper bracing frame, and the video shooting portion is connected with the upper bracing frame via a third rotating shaft. Through the folding of the two section bracing frame, the whole shooting device can be folded into one with a small volume, thus being easy to carry. The two-shot file shooting device has two shots with one being used for file shooting and the other one for network video, thus becoming a diversified and multi-functional product, and enhancing the practicability.

Description

Twin-lens file recording instrument
[technical field]
The utility model relates to the file recording instrument, relates in particular to the file recording instrument with twin-lens.
[background technology]
The file recording instrument has another name called " the high instrument of clapping ", this equipment generally is to be used for down taking from eminence, whole part file all taken be graphic file, this instrument generally has a base, extend upward a up-right support from base portion then with certain altitude, the camera lens of taking file then just is mounted on the top part of up-right support, on the gravitational equilibrium angle, the up-right support height is high more, the scope that camera lens can be expanded is wide more, then center of gravity is hard to keep more on base, promptly in order to allow the coverage of camera lens wider, the weight mass of base is big more, can hold whole center of gravity, so just cause file recording instrument heaviness, be difficult to mobilely be inconvenient to carry.In addition, the effect of generic-document recording instrument is single, only can be as the usefulness of taking scanning document, show slightly single deficiency on comprehensive application.
[summary of the invention]
The utility model provides a kind of, and to have a slim counterweight base, integral body can more piece folding, can be folded in the time of obsolete that minimum takes up room, the file recording instrument of the small and exquisite light weight of volume, and this instrument has the not camera of same-action of two different angles, finishes and takes and the video multi-functional.
The technical solution of the utility model is: a kind of twin-lens file recording instrument, has a base, collapsible bracing frame and shooting head, described collapsible bracing frame is connected on the base, be provided with the shooting head at collapsible supporting framing front end, it is characterized in that, it is folding that described collapsible bracing frame is divided into two joints, be rotatably connected by first rotating shaft between two joints, be received into down fully in the half-section grooved space after last half-section is folding, half-section supporting framing front end on described, has a photographing section, described photographing section is connected by second rotating shaft with last half-section bracing frame before, in the one side of last half-section bracing frame towards inside, has the video capture part, described video capture partly is arranged on one and is embedded in the middle vacancy part of half-section bracing frame, and described video capture partly is connected with last half-section bracing frame by the 3rd rotating shaft.
The rotational angle of second rotating shaft between described photographing section and the last half-section bracing frame is-90 °~90 °, be vertical between photographing section and the last half-section bracing frame during two extreme positions, during the centre position, be straight line between photographing section and the last half-section bracing frame.
The first rotating shaft rotational angle between last half-section bracing frame and the following half-section bracing frame is 0 degree~120 degree, and when 0 degree extreme position, last half-section bracing frame and following half-section bracing frame folded closed then present 120 degree between the two together when opening maximum angle.
Described video capture partly is the two-stage revolving member, and the upper end is rotationally connected by the 3rd rotating shaft and last half-section bracing frame inboard, is connected by vertical rotating shaft between lower end and the upper end, and then the latter half is around central symmetry axis 360 degree rotations own.
Described first rotating shaft, second rotating shaft, the 3rd rotating shaft are at space parallel.
The beneficial effects of the utility model are: by two joint folding support frames can be one with whole recording instrument folding, become very little volume, easily carry, have two camera lenses in addition, one is used for one of file shooting and is used for Internet video, the lifting of diversification multifunctional product practicality.
